Viability of resource theories in explaining time-sharing performance

P S Tsang1, V L Velazquez, M A Vidulich

  • 1Department of Psychology, Wright State University, Dayton, OH 45430, USA. ptsang@nova.wright.edu.

Acta Psychologica
|March 1, 1996
PubMed
Summary

This study investigated performance tradeoffs in dual-tasking using the optimum-maximum method. Results show voluntary resource allocation influences performance, supporting multiple resource theories of task interference.
